Abstract :
This paper considers the synthesis of quasi-parameter dependent linear systems from a class of nonlinear differential equations describing certain nonlinear systems. The method presented facilitates the process of designing controllers that are also parameter-dependent. It exploits some recent techniques for synthesising gain-scheduled controllers that incorporate the available measurement of the dependent parameter and results in higher performance, since it automatically adjust to the current plant dynamics. Hidden coupling terms which normally occur in this process are formally addressed
